Software/ Systems Engineer Resume
Nyc, NY
SUMMARY
- Over 7 years of experience in UI development, Frontend development, Flash with Action Script, Rich User Interface Design, Development, Web 2.0 specifications and documentation.
- Experience in Software life cycle phases like Requirement Analysis, Implementation and estimating the time - lines for the project.
- Proficient in building Web User Interface (UI) using HTML5, CSS3, DHTML, tableless XHTML and JavaScript that follows W3C Web Standards and are browser compatible.
- Expert in working with cutting edge front-end technologies/frameworkand librarieslikeJQuery,Prototype,DWR2.0,(X)HTML,DHTML,OOJavaScript,JSON, DOM,CSS,XML/XSLT,AJAX.
- Expertise in building strong websites confirming Web 2.0 standards using Yahoo UserInterface (YUI) Framework, JQuery, HTML, XHTML, DHTML&CSS to develop valid code and table - free sites.
- Experience in Web 2.0 applications like blog maintenance, Library Management, Social Networking using HTML, DHTML, and JavaScript.
- Expert in designing web applications and web contents utilizing various Search Engine Optimization (SEO)techniques.
- Working knowledge of Web protocols and standards (HTTP HTML/XHTML/XHTML-MP, Web Forms, XML, XML parsers).
- Experience in designing UI patterns and UI applications with the help of Adobe products like Adobe DreamweaverCS3, Adobe Photoshop CS3/CS4, Adobe Fireworks CS3 and Adobe Illustrator CS3.
- Experience on working with CSS Background, CSS Layouts, CSS positioning, CSS text, CSS border, CSS margin, CSS padding, CSS table, Pseudo classes, Pseudo elements and CSS behaviours in CSS.
- Expertise in working with the JavaScript, prototype JS and various MVC JavaScript frameworks backbone.js and node.js.
- Experience in working with Ghostwrite.js (Script Management Framework) to download the Display ads in the site.
- Experience in developing web based applications using Google Web Toolkit (GWT) and J2EE Servlet technology.
- Extensive experience in creating style guides, best practices and setting UI standards for enterprise/consumer applications.
- Proficient with creating Logos, Banners, Buttons, Icons and Images using Adobe Flash and Adobe Illustrator.
- Excellent experience in Restful Web services and Big Web service development and consumption using (JAX-RS and JAX-WS).
- Experience working with testing tools like Firebug, Firebug Lite, Chrome or Safari Web Inspectors and IE Developer Toolbar.
- Experience using database systems MySQL, Oracle, Sybase and supporting technologies like Hibernate.
- Experienced in working in AGILE based development environment and participating in Scrum sessions.
- Ability to write well-documented, well-commented, clear and maintainable efficient code for web development.
- Experience with Browser testing, knowledge of cross-browser/cross-platform compatibility.
- Strong communication, collaboration & team building skills with proficiency in grasping new technical concepts quickly.
- Self-starter always inclined to learn new technologies and Team Player with very good communication, organizational and interpersonal skills.
TECHNICAL SKILLS
Web Technologies: HTML/HTML5, CSS2/CSS3, DHTML, XML, XHTML, XSLT, JavaScript, AJAX, JQuery, JSON, Apache, PHP
JavaScript Libraries: Ext JS 2.0/1.0, Backbone.js 0.9.2, Node.js, AngularJS, jQueryUI
IDE's and Tools: Eclipse IDE, NetBean, Dreamweaver, FireBug, Developer Tools, EditPlus, JSfiddle, Webstrom, Tatastrom, Sublimetext
Development Tools: Adobe Photoshop CS5, Google Ad Words, Yahoo Search Marketing(spring tool suite)
Publishing Tools: Adobe PageMaker, MS Office
Wire Frame Tools(wire frame): Adobe Illustrator CS3(basic idea on wire frame and visual design)
Debugging Tools: Firebug, BugZilla, (internet explorer)
Database: PL/SQL(oracle), MySQL, MSSQL
Operating System: Windows 98/2000/XP/Vista/7/8, MAC OS X
PROFESSIONAL EXPERIENCE
Confidential, Piscataway, New Jersey
Sr. Front End UI Developer
Responsibilities:
- Developed front end UI applications for the business and software systems which consists of Confidential standards.
- Used the functionalities to write code in HTML5/HTML, CSS3/CSS, Angular.js, JavaScript, JQUERY, Ajax, JSON, and Bootstrap with MySQL database as the backend.
- The project is built upon the Single Page Application (SPA) criteria.
- Developed server side REST style web services and called them from angular controllers.
- Involved in developing a new business application to the layout using Grid orientation model Bootstrap framework.
- Developed JQuery code using anXMLHttpRequest Adapter to send a AJAX request to the server side code and also implemented a callback function to handle the results.
- Implemented JavaScript source code and embedded nested handling logic using JQuery event handlers and call back functions.
- Web application development for backend system using Angular with cutting edge HTML5 and CSS3 techniques.
- Developed the JQuery callback functions for implementing asynchronous communication using AJAX.
- For new website features wrote Angular controllers, views and services.
- Coding, styling, testing of reusable JavaScript, CSS3, HTML5 widgets/ libraries for complete UI controls.
- Designed user friendly navigation for displaying various sections of data using JQuery.
- Created Dynamic Web Pages using Web Controls and developed forms using HTML5.
- Styling pages using CSS3.0 and developed JavaScript for user interfaces.
- Frequently met with the project manager to review project goals and to create proposals for future developments, researching their fields for UI design.
Environment: HTML5, CSS, Bootstrap, Angular.js, AJAX, JQuery, JavaScript, MVC, Rest Web Services, JSON, MySQL Server, Eclipse
Confidential, Kent, OH
Sr. Web Developer
Responsibilities:
- Involved in Designing, Implementation, Maintenance and Testing of Databases and Web pages.
- Involved in Designing and programming standard based websites for medium sized businesses utilizing HTML5/HTML, CSS3/CSS, JavaScript, PHP, JQuery and MYSQL.
- Used Angular.js, JQuery, JavaScript, HTML5, and CSS3 for front end web designing.
- Used views, which present data to the users; controllers, which manages the $scope and expose behaviour to the view; directives, which connects user interactions to $scope.
- Worked on Dreamweaver to create web pages using HTML5/HTML, CSS3/CSS and JavaScript.
- Used JavaScript to implement validation logic as well as AJAX to provide a flicker free refresh feature for the front end.
- Expertise in coding, testing, implementation/ maintenance support in PHP and MySQL.
- Used HTML Editors to develop the HTML layouts of various web pages.
- PHP coding for manually prepared forms.
- Developed CSS styles in order to maintain consistency of the web user interface.
- Designed user friendly navigation for displaying various sections of data using JQuery.
- Perform a variety of administrative tasks including preparation of Power Point presentations, data entry and analysis, web site development and presentations.
- Facilitate projects in an office with other team members; serve on college project teams.
Environment: HTML5, CSS, Angular.js, Bootstrap, AJAX, PHP, JQuery, MySQL, JavaScript, C#.net, Eclipse, JSON, Rest Web Services
Confidential, NYC, NY
Front End Developer
Responsibilities:
- Implemented various Employee Self Service front end UI Applications developed for easy lookup and creation of HR Records for various Employees.
- Used Angular.js, JQuery, JavaScript, HTML5, and CSS for front end web designing.
- Used MVC architecture of backbone.js to convert nested jQuery calls into a backbone model based architecture.
- Developed server side REST style web services and called them from backbone models/collections.
- Created Dynamic Web Pages using Web Controls.
- Rewrote existing CSS to form adaptive and responsive layouts for mobile UI.
- Developed forms using HTML5.
- Styling pages using CSS3.0 and developed JavaScript for user interfaces.
- Ajax calls to REST web services.
- Designed, developed and implemented the database in Microsoft SQL Server for the application
- Used Selectors in JQuery for updating content on DOM nodes.
- Built html templates for high traffic and complex data driven websites.
- Meet with the project manager to determine website goals and develop strategies for creating a strong web presence.
Environment: HTML5, CSS, Angular.js, Bootstrap, AJAX, JQuery, MySQL, JavaScript, Eclipse, JSON, Rest Web Services
Confidential
Software/ Systems Engineer
Responsibilities:
- Interacted with the clients to get site - specific requirements and perform analysis and design for client specific requirements.
- Designed and developed Payment and collection module and delivered successfully with technologies like Web Service, spring, JPA.
- Designed and developed prepaid billing server communication and services with java sockets.
- Designed and developed EJB APIs for Subscriber functionalities Provisioning, Activation, suspend, cancelation using EJB 3.
- Designed and developed UI and backend functionality in JSF, Rich faces, JBoss Seam and JPA, EJB3.
- Debugged and fixed existed version EJB, hibernate issues.
- Developed various web services server API's save plan phase data with axis frame work.
- Developed multi-threading plan and execute phase split node move.
- Developed SQL and PL/SQL scripts for save and execute phases date to retrieve and save to Oracle.
Environment: Java, HTML, DHTML, JavaScript, JSP, JSF, Struts, Web Services, Eclipse, SOAP, XML, Hibernate, SQL, PL/SQL, Oracle, Windows XP.
Confidential
Jr. UI Developer
Responsibilities:
- Designed the website and created/developed web interfaces.
- Created graphics including Icons, Images and logos using Adobe Flash Catalyst.
- Created appropriate concept models, site organization, navigation, page layouts and interaction to support company s needs and goals.
- Used Dreamweaver as HTML Editor for designing new pages.
- Developed HTML prototype documents with CSS Style Sheets.
- Designed dynamic client - side JavaScript codes to build web forms and simulate process for web application, page navigation and form validation.
- Did Cross - Browser coding, for making pages compatible will all browsers.
- Worked closely with the programmers for project requirement analysis.
- Enhanced website by creating presenting new static models pages and presenting it to senior managementfor attracting the customers and existing users.
- Performed validation of completed sites including the debugging and testing of code.
Environment: Java, JavaScript, HTML, DHTML, CSS, Adobe Flash, SQL, Oracle, Windows.